Pricing and Cost Advice

"The full ALM license lets you use the requirements tab, along with test automation and the Performance Center. You can also just buy the Quality Center edition (Manual testing only), or the Performance Center version (Performance Testing only)."
"For pricing, I recommend to buy a bundled package. Check the HPE site for more details."
"Seat and concurrent licensing models exist; the latter is recommended if a large number of different users will be utilizing the product."
"ALM Quality Center is a little bit costly."
"It allows us to keep our costs low. I do not want to pay beyond a certain point for this solution."
"I've never been in the procurement process for it. I don't think it is cheap. Some of the features can be quite expensive."
"The solution is priceed high."
"The pricing is expensive nowadays."
"It costs a couple of thousand dollars for a little more than 125 users, per month."
"DFS is more expensive than Zephyr. DFS is around $32 per person, whereas Zephyr is $10 per person. There is a major difference in the price, which is the main reason why we are trying to shift to Zephyr."

Questions from the Community

What is your experience regarding pricing and costs for Micro Focus ALM Quality Center?
The on-premises setup tends to be on the expensive side. It would be cheaper to use a cloud model with a pay-per-use licensing model.

What needs improvement with Zephyr Enterprise?
Some areas for improvement, include its export capabilities. Exporting test cases, especially those with screenshots or attachments, can be cumbersome, hindering easy sharing and scalability.
